Italian
Etymology
From cicatrice + -izzare.
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/t͡ʃi.ka.tridˈd͡za.re/
- Rhymes: -are
- Hyphenation: ci‧ca‧triz‧zà‧re
Verb
cicatrizzàre (first-person singular present cicatrìzzo, first-person singular past historic cicatrizzài, past participle cicatrizzàto, auxiliary (transitive) avére or (intransitive) èssere)
- (transitive) to cicatrize, to heal (a wound) by scar formation
- (intransitive) to cicatrize, to heal by scar formation (of a wound)
